About the RoleIn this role, you will design highly scalable and high performing technology solutions in an Agile work environment and produce and deliver code and/or test cases using wide-ranging experience, professional concepts, company objectives and Agile practices. You will collaborate closely with key business support teams, product managers, architecture to assist in resolving complex critical cross-team and cross-domain production issues to help simplify and improve business processes through the latest in technology and automation. You are a technical expert and will lead through the requirements gathering, design, development, deployment, and support phases of a product. You will leverage your comprehensive knowledge of domain and core programming technologies or packages to mentor and advise team members.What You'll Do
-
Lead significant projects and define technical specifications and development requirements that result in high performing technology that are also domain specific.
-
Develop and enhance product and/or applications independently to solve complex business problems by keeping customer experience at the forefront.
-
Adopt and model a DevOps mindset by applying automation, continuous integration and continuous delivery in everything we do.
-
Foster innovation by applying best practices and learning from emerging technologies and through collaboration with cross functional stakeholders.
-
Communicate difficult concepts and lead teams through design and interpretation.
-
Mentor and subject matter expert in support of domain areas, leading assignments of diverse scope.
-
Balances project delivery objectives with organizational initiatives.
Who You Are
-
Software Development experience and knowledge of the Software Delivery Lifecycle, Security Compliance and Agile and SCRUM methodology, industry and competitor practices.
-
Comprehensive knowledge of various software languages and platforms such as Java, Oracle, Azure etc.
-
Expert at leading technical requirements and interpretation of business requirements.
-
Experience with leading significant projects and mentoring teams.
-
Experience with developing teams that are cross functional and include internal and external stakeholders.